What Key Features Should a Bag for Traveling in Thailand Have?
The best bag for traveling in Thailand should encompass several key features to enhance convenience and comfort.
- Water Resistance: A bag that offers water resistance is crucial in Thailand due to the tropical climate and sudden rain showers. This feature helps protect your belongings from getting wet and damaged, ensuring that important items like electronics and clothing stay dry.
- Lightweight Design: Given the need for mobility while exploring, a lightweight bag can significantly ease the burden on your shoulders. This design allows you to carry it for extended periods without fatigue, which is essential when navigating through bustling markets or on public transport.
- Multiple Compartments: A bag with several compartments allows for better organization of your travel essentials. This feature helps you quickly access items like passports, travel documents, and personal belongings without having to rummage through the entire bag.
- Security Features: Security is a top concern for travelers, especially in crowded areas. Look for bags that offer lockable zippers, anti-theft designs, or hidden compartments that can deter pickpockets and keep your valuables safe.
- Comfortable Straps: Comfort is key for long days of sightseeing, so a bag with padded and adjustable straps can enhance your carrying experience. This feature reduces strain on your back and shoulders, allowing you to enjoy your travels without discomfort.
- Durable Material: A bag made from durable, high-quality materials can withstand the wear and tear of travel. This durability is important for protecting your belongings and ensuring that the bag lasts throughout your journey across diverse terrains.
- Size and Capacity: The ideal size and capacity depend on your travel style, but a bag that is not too bulky yet spacious enough for essentials is ideal. A medium-sized bag can accommodate day-to-day items without being cumbersome, making it easier to navigate through Thailand’s busy streets.

How Does Weather Resistance Impact Your Bag Choice?
Weather resistance is a crucial factor to consider when selecting the best bag for Thailand, given the country’s tropical climate and frequent rain.
- Waterproof Materials: Bags made with waterproof materials such as nylon or polyester are ideal for Thailand’s unpredictable rains. These materials prevent water from seeping through, keeping your belongings dry and protected during sudden downpours.
- Sealed Zippers: Sealed or water-resistant zippers enhance the weather resistance of a bag. They prevent moisture from entering through the zipper openings, which is particularly useful during heavy rain or when crossing wet environments.
- Rain Covers: Some bags come with built-in rain covers or have the option to add one. These covers provide an extra layer of protection against heavy rainfall, ensuring that your gear remains dry even in the worst weather conditions.
- Ventilation Features: Bags designed with ventilation features help to reduce moisture buildup inside. This is important in humid climates like Thailand, as it helps prevent mildew and keeps your items fresh during extended outings.
- Durability and UV Resistance: Choosing a bag with durable materials that resist UV rays can prevent fading and damage from prolonged sun exposure. This is particularly relevant for outdoor activities in Thailand, where the sun can be intense.

What Types of Bags Are Most Suitable for Traveling in Thailand?
When traveling in Thailand, selecting the right bag is essential for comfort and practicality.
- Daypack: A daypack is ideal for carrying essentials during day trips and city explorations. It is generally lightweight, easy to carry, and can hold items like water bottles, snacks, and a camera while leaving your hands free for other activities.
- Travel Backpack: A travel backpack offers more storage and is suitable for longer trips or if you plan to carry more gear. These backpacks often come with compartments for organization and are designed to be comfortable for extended wear, making them perfect for trekking in Thailand’s beautiful landscapes.
- Crossbody Bag: A crossbody bag is great for keeping valuables secure and within reach while you navigate busy markets or tourist spots. Its design allows for easy access and typically includes anti-theft features, which can add peace of mind in crowded areas.
- Wet/Dry Bag: This type of bag is particularly useful if you plan to engage in water activities or visit Thailand’s beautiful beaches. With a waterproof section, it can keep your electronics dry while allowing you to store wet swimsuits or towels without mixing them with your dry belongings.
- Travel Tote: A travel tote can serve as a versatile option for both shopping and daily excursions. Its spacious design is perfect for carrying souvenirs or snacks, and many totes are foldable, making them easy to pack away when not in use.

When is a Travel Tote the Best Option for Thailand?
The Travel Tote is the best option for Thailand in several scenarios, particularly due to its versatility and practicality.
- Day Trips: A travel tote is ideal for day trips to explore cities or beaches, as it can comfortably hold essentials like water, snacks, a camera, and sunscreen without being cumbersome.
- Market Visits: When visiting local markets, a travel tote allows for easy access to your belongings while providing ample space for any purchases you make, such as souvenirs or local delicacies.
- Lightweight Packing: For travelers who prefer to pack minimally, a travel tote serves as an efficient option, allowing you to carry just the necessities without the weight of a larger suitcase.
- Transport Flexibility: Travel totes are often more flexible in terms of transport, fitting easily under bus seats or in the overhead compartments of planes, making them a convenient choice for getting around Thailand.
- Outdoor Activities: If you’re engaging in outdoor adventures like hiking or beach outings, a travel tote can be easily packed with water bottles, towels, and snacks, making it a practical choice for such activities.

How Does Bag Size Affect Your Travel Experience in Thailand?
The size of your bag can significantly influence your travel experience in Thailand, impacting convenience, mobility, and storage.
- Small Daypack: A small daypack is ideal for daily excursions, allowing you to carry essentials like water, snacks, and a camera without being cumbersome.
- Medium Backpack: A medium-sized backpack offers a balance between carrying capacity and portability, making it suitable for multi-day trips and accommodating clothing and gear while still being manageable.
- Large Wheeled Suitcase: A large wheeled suitcase is perfect for longer stays or if you plan to travel with more items, though it can be cumbersome on uneven terrain or in crowded areas.
- Travel Duffle Bag: A travel duffle bag combines flexibility and space, allowing you to pack a variety of items while being easy to carry and store in tight spaces.
- Convertible Backpack: A convertible backpack provides the versatility of transforming into a suitcase, offering the best of both worlds for travelers who want ease of carrying along with ample storage.
A small daypack is perfect for exploring cities or going on short hikes, as it is lightweight and easy to maneuver through bustling markets and narrow streets. This bag typically holds a few essentials and keeps your hands free for navigation or taking photos.
A medium-sized backpack can accommodate more items, such as extra clothing and personal items, making it suitable for travelers planning to stay longer or explore rural areas. Its size is manageable for public transport and can easily fit in overhead compartments on buses and trains.
A large wheeled suitcase is beneficial for travelers who prefer to bring a lot of gear or are staying in one place, as it provides ample storage space. However, navigating through crowded areas or uneven pavements can be challenging, making it less ideal for certain locations in Thailand.
A travel duffle bag is great for those who need flexibility, as it can be easily folded when empty and packed into other bags. It can also accommodate larger items and is often made from durable materials, making it suitable for outdoor adventures.
A convertible backpack is an excellent choice for those who want to switch between carrying styles without sacrificing space. This type of bag allows you to have the convenience of a backpack while also offering the option to wheel it like a suitcase, catering to different travel scenarios.
